Lobo Hostel - Rurrenabaque features an outdoor swimming pool, garden, a shared lounge and terrace in Rurrenabaque. There is free private parking and the property offers paid airport shuttle service.

At the hostel, all rooms come with a patio with a mountain view. All rooms are fitted with a private bathroom and a shower, and certain units at Lobo Hostel - Rurrenabaque have a balcony. The units feature bed linen.

Very nice hostel with a swimming pool by the river, breakfast and helpful staff. I was able to leave my bags while on a jungle trip. Very convenient laundry service as well (fast option in 8h available). They also organized my pick-up from the hostel in tuktuk which was great.
